2020-12-16varasm: Fix up __patchable_function_entries handlingJakub Jelinek1-3/+3
The SECTION_LINK_ORDER changes don't seem to work properly. If I compile: static inline __attribute__((__gnu_inline__)) __attribute__((__unused__)) __attribute__((patchable_function_entry(0, 0))) int foo (int x) { return x + 1; } static inline __attribute__((__gnu_inline__)) __attribute__((__unused__)) __attribute__((patchable_function_entry(0, 0))) int bar (int x) { return x + 2; } int baz (int x) { return foo (x) + 1; } int qux (int x) { return bar (x) + 2; } (distilled from aarch64 Linux kernel) with -O2 -fpatchable-function-entry=2 on aarch64 compiler configured against latest binutils, I get: ... .section __patchable_function_entries,"awo",@progbits,baz ... .section __patchable_function_entries ... in the assembly, but when it is assembled, one gets: [ 4] __patchable_function_entries PROGBITS 0000000000000000 000060 000008 00 WAL 1 0 8 [ 5] .rela__patchable_function_entries RELA 0000000000000000 000280 000018 18 I 12 4 8 [ 6] __patchable_function_entries PROGBITS 0000000000000000 000068 000008 00 0 0 8 [ 7] .rela__patchable_function_entries RELA 0000000000000000 000298 000018 18 I 12 6 8 i.e. one writable allocated section with SHF_LINK_ORDER and another non-allocated non-writable without link order. In the kernel case there is always one entry in the WAL section and then dozens or more in the non-allocated one. The kernel then fails to link: WARNING: modpost: vmlinux.o (__patchable_function_entries): unexpected non-allocatable section. Did you forget to use "ax"/"aw" in a .S file? Note that for example <linux/init.h> contains section definitions for use in .S files. ld: .init.data has both ordered [`__patchable_function_entries' in init/main.o] and unordered [`.init.data' in +./drivers/firmware/efi/libstub/vsprintf.stub.o] sections ld: final link failed: bad value make: *** [Makefile:1175: vmlinux] Error 1 The following patch fixes it by always forcing full section flags for SECTION_LINK_ORDER sections. 2020-12-16 Jakub Jelinek <jakub@redhat.com> * varasm.c (default_elf_asm_named_section): Always force section flags even for sections with SECTION_LINK_ORDER flag.

2020-12-16bswap: Handle vector CONSTRUCTORs [PR96239]Jakub Jelinek2-5/+140
The following patch teaches the bswap pass to handle for small (2/4/8 byte long) vectors a CONSTRUCTOR by determining if the bytes of the constructor come from non-vector sources and are either nop or bswap and changing the CONSTRUCTOR in that case to VIEW_CONVERT_EXPR from scalar integer to the vector type. Unfortunately, as I found after the patch was written, due to pass ordering this doesn't really fix the original testcase, just the one I wrote, because both loop and slp vectorization is done only after the bswap pass. A possible way out of that would be to perform just this particular bswap optimization (i.e. for CONSTRUCTOR assignments with integral vector types call find_bswap_or_nop and bswap_replace if successful) also during the store merging pass, it isn't really a store, but the store merging pass already performs bswapping when handling store, so it wouldn't be that big hack. What do you think? 2020-12-16 Jakub Jelinek <jakub@redhat.com> PR tree-optimization/96239 * gimple-ssa-store-merging.c (find_bswap_or_nop): Handle a vector CONSTRUCTOR. (bswap_replace): Likewise. * gcc.dg/pr96239.c: New test.

2020-12-16rs6000: Use subreg for QI/HI vector initKewen Lin3-11/+5
This patch is to use paradoxical subreg instead of zero_extend for promoting QI/HI to SI/DI when we want to construct one vector with these modes. Since we do the gpr->vsx movement and vector merge or pack later, the high part is useless and safe to use paradoxical subreg. It can avoid useless rlwinms generated for signed cases. Bootstrapped/regtested on powerpc64le-linux-gnu P9. gcc/ChangeLog: * config/rs6000/rs6000.c (rs6000_expand_vector_init): Use paradoxical subreg instead of zero_extend for QI/HI promotion. gcc/testsuite/ChangeLog: * gcc.target/powerpc/pr96933-1.c: Adjusted to check no rlwinm. * gcc.target/powerpc/pr96933-2.c: Likewise.

2020-12-15match.pd: Optimize X / bool_range_Y to X [PR96094]Jakub Jelinek2-4/+43
When the divisor is bool or has [0, 1] range, as division by 0 is UB, the only remaining option in valid programs is division by 1, so we can optimize X / bool_range_Y into X. 2020-12-15 Jakub Jelinek <jakub@redhat.com> PR tree-optimization/96094 * match.pd (X / bool_range_Y -> X): New simplification. * gcc.dg/tree-ssa/pr96094.c: New test.
